FP7209 Non-Synchronous PWM Boost Controller for LED Driver General Description The FP7209 is boost topology switching regulator for LED driver. It provides built-in gate driver pin for driving external N-MOSFET. The non-inverting input of error amplifier connects to a 0.25V reference voltage. There are three functions to protect system circuit like UVP, OVP and OCP. The LED current can be adjusted by an external signal connecting to the DIM pin. DIM pin accepts either a DC voltage or a PWM signal. The PWM signal filter components are contained within the chip. Current mode control and external compensation network make is easy and flexible to stabilize the system. The FP7209 is available in the small footprint SOP-8L(EP) package to fit in space-saving PCB layout for application fields. Features  Start-up Voltage: 2.8V  Wide Supply Voltage Operating Range: 5V to 24V  Precision Feedback Reference Voltage: 0.25V (Max.)  Analog and Digital Dimming Control  Shutdown Current: 6μA (Max.)  Fixed Switching Frequency: 150KHz  Input Under Voltage Protection (UVP)  Output Over Voltage Protection (OVP)  Switching MOSFET Over Current Protection (OCP)  Over Temperature Protection (OTP)  Package: SOP-8L(EP) Applications  LED Module  Display Backlight  Car Lighting  Portable LED Lighting This datasheet contains new product information.
